    OpenAI, one of the world's leading artificial intelligence (AI) research labs, has announced the release of GPT-5, the newest version of its widely used AI model. While previous iterations have made a significant impact across various sectors, GPT-5 promises to bring unprecedented changes to the world of finance.

    AI models like GPT-5 are capable of understanding and generating human-like text, making them incredibly useful in numerous applications. In the financial sector, these models have the potential to revolutionize trading, risk management, and financial planning. GPT-5's enhanced capabilities could provide more accurate financial projections and market analysis, influencing investment decisions and business strategies.

    But the widespread use of such advanced AI also raises critical ethical and regulatory challenges. As AI models become more sophisticated, ensuring their responsible and transparent use becomes increasingly challenging. From algorithmic bias to concerns over data privacy, the rise of AI has brought a host of new issues that policymakers and regulators need to address.

    Moreover, the advent of GPT-5 underscores the growing importance of AI literacy for investors, financial advisors, and businesses. Understanding how these models work and the insights they can deliver is no longer a luxury, but a necessity in today's data-driven economy.

    Investors, for example, can leverage GPT-5's advanced analytics to make more informed decisions. The model's ability to analyze vast amounts of data and generate insights could provide a competitive edge in a market increasingly influenced by AI-driven trading. Similarly, financial advisors can use GPT-5 to offer more personalized advice, based on a deeper understanding of each client's financial situation and goals.

    Businesses, meanwhile, can use GPT-5's predictive capabilities to better plan for the future. By analyzing market trends and economic indicators, the model can help companies anticipate changes in consumer behavior, competitive dynamics, or regulatory environments. This can assist in designing more effective strategies, managing risks, and seizing new opportunities.

    However, the increasing reliance on AI also comes with risks. As these models become more integrated into financial decision-making, any flaws or biases in their programming can have significant consequences. Therefore, it is crucial for users to understand the limitations of AI and consider these when interpreting the model's outputs.
